Groundsel logo #10004(Senecio) This is a large group of hardy and tender annuals and perennials that may have shrubby, herbaceous, or climbing growth. Senecios are found wild in almost every country, especially in southern Europe; others are found in South Africa, New Zealand, Australia, China, Japan, the United States and Mexico. Groundsel logo #21217Groundsel (Senecio) is a genus of plants of the family Compositae native to Europe, Asia and Northern Africa. The plants are emollient, have a slightly acid taste and is rejected by most animals except pigs and goats and particularly rabbits which love to eat it.
